About the Role
The Account Director serves as the primary client contact, managing relationships with Airline, Cruise Line, and Hotel partners to maximize client satisfaction and API's interests.
Responsibilities
- Oversee existing API accounts to maximize relationships and expand market share against revenue quotas.
- Collaborate with Research & Sourcing teams to provide destination details for seamless sourcing.
- Initiate the RFP process for destination sourcing, maintaining sensitivity to supplier relationships.
- Ensure RFP results are accurately documented in client presentations, meeting client needs, savings, and API revenue goals.
- Strategically plan and organize to maximize API revenue and client savings, including managing sourcing timelines for expiring contracts and renewals.
- Conduct domestic and international hotel site inspections with clients to ensure properties meet criteria.
- Execute hotel contract negotiations and renewals on behalf of clients, aiming for mutually beneficial terms.
- Monitor market conditions to maintain optimal rates, amenities, and contract terms.
- Conduct risk management for serviced destinations, proactively addressing potential contract risks and negotiating favorable terms.
- Maintain strong hotel relationships for contracted clients.
- Collaborate with the sales team to meet client needs and share leads.
- Manage crew member feedback via the online portal, addressing complaints promptly with hotel partners.
- Add new hotels to the system, ensure accuracy, and delete inactive hotels.
- Ensure negotiated rates for crew, business, and leisure travel are loaded and maintained on HotelExpress.
- Verify hotel contract information is loaded correctly into ACES for OPS and Accounting.
- Review ACES schedules monthly and assist the OPS department with hotel follow-ups.
- Verify client backup lists are accurate and loaded into ACES.
- Ensure all revenue opportunities are entered into the CRM with accurate business start dates.
- Ensure all hotel/airline and API commission contracts are loaded, executed, and attached to the CRM.
- Maintain all flight information.
- Understand client business thoroughly and ensure all deliverables are met.
- Propose new ideas and recommendations aligned with client business goals to create increased value.
- Collaborate with the Business Development team for smooth client transitions.
- Independently lead and make decisions balancing client and API needs.
- Manage all client communications, including performance meetings and business reviews.
- Own internal communications to the cross-functional team regarding client performance, strategies, and needs.
- Become knowledgeable in all API technology platforms to align clients with appropriate software solutions.
